International Day in Support of Victims of Torture: Statement by the High Representative/Vice-President Kaja Kallas

Torture is prohibited under international law in all circumstances, with no exception. Yet it persists, often hidden from view and with impunity. Far from only affecting individuals in detention, UN reporting shows that torture is increasingly used to silence political dissent and prevent people from exercising fundamental freedoms, including the freedom of expression and peaceful assemb...

São Tomé e Príncipe: The European Union deploys an Election Observation Mission

In response to an invitation from the Santomean authorities, an EU Election Observation Mission (EOM) will be deployed to observe the presidential elections as well as the legislative, local and regional elections scheduled for 19 July and 27 September 2026 respectively. Colombia: Statement by the Spokesperson on the presidential elections

The European Union congratulates Abelardo de la Espriella for his election as President of Colombia, as well as the Colombian people for the conduct of peaceful elections with record participation numbers. Kuwait: Statement by the Spokesperson on the latest executions

The European Union regrets the latest executions of five people in Kuwait and remains concerned with the increased use of capital punishment in the country during the last two years. The European Union strongly opposes the death penalty in all cases and in all circumstances. Jordan: Statement by the Spokesperson on the latest executions

The European Union regrets the executions of 6 individuals on 21 June 2026. Since 2017, Jordan had upheld a de facto moratorium on executions and capital punishment. The EU reiterates its unequivocal opposition to the death penalty in all cases and under all circumstances. Zambia: The European Union deploys an Election Observation Mission

In response to a formal invitation by the Government of Zambia, an EU Election Observation Mission (EOM) will be deployed to observe the general elections in the Republic of Zambia on 13 August 2026.
